Transaction 33250e44f88fff7ee93428984c1da69a1aba4209532aec9df1889887fc1354fb
1 Input
1 Output
-
33250e44f88fff7ee93428984c1da69a1aba4209532aec9df1889887fc1354fb:0
- value
- 887059
- script pubkey
- OP_0 OP_PUSHBYTES_20 7497008995417164b7ae2b030e30fd7697e76de6
- address
- bc1qwjtspzv4g9ckfdaw9vpsuv8aw6t7wm0xh80zxk